BARCELONA: A flotilla of ships was preparing to set sail for the Gaza Strip Sunday with humanitarian aid on board, while Israel stepped up its offensive on Gaza City and is limiting the deliveries of food and basic supplies in the north of the Palestinian territory. The Global Sumud Flotilla will try to break the Israeli blockade of the Palestinian territory and bring humanitarian aid, food, water and medicine to Gaza.
